- Topic: Loss briefly spiked, then recovered. What happened?
- Replies: 4
- Views: 3451
Re: Loss briefly spiked, then recovered. What happened?
This is usually a sign of an overclocked GPU. The other option is exploding gradients that recovered -- which is far more rare. The fact it was uniform for A and B tells me the GPU is more likely the culprit.
